U.S. average auto insurance rates for an Audi e-tron GT are $2,108 annually including full coverage. Comprehensive insurance costs around $532, collision insurance costs $1,102, and liability costs around $338. Liability-only coverage costs as low as $394 a year, and high-risk coverage costs $4,600 or more. Teen drivers pay the highest rates at up to $7,342 a year.

Average premium for full coverage: $2,108

Price estimates for individual coverage:

Comprehensive $532
Collision $1102
Liability $338

Prices are based on $500 comprehensive and collision deductibles, minimum liability limits, and includes both medical and uninsured motorist insurance. Estimates are averaged for all 50 U.S. states and for all e-tron GT models.

Auto insurance prices for an Audi e-tron GT are also quite variable based on the trim level and model year, your driving characteristics, and deductibles and policy limits.

A more mature driver with a good driving record and high physical damage deductibles may pay as low as $1,900 a year for full coverage. Prices are highest for teenage drivers, where even without any violations or accidents they will have to pay as much as $7,300 a year. View Rates by Age

If you have some driving violations or you caused a few accidents, you are likely paying at least $2,500 to $3,300 in extra premium each year, depending on your age. Audi e-tron GT insurance for high-risk drivers can be from 45% to 133% more than average. View High Risk Driver Rates

Choosing high deductibles could cut prices by as much as $1,100 annually, whereas buying more liability protection will increase prices. Changing from a 50/100 bodily injury limit to a 250/500 limit will increase prices by as much as $304 extra every year. View Rates by Deductible or Liability Limit

The state you live in has a huge impact on Audi e-tron GT insurance prices. A driver around age 40 might see prices as low as $1,610 a year in states like Missouri, New Hampshire, and Vermont, or as much as $3,000 on average in Michigan, New York, and Louisiana.

Rates by Driver Age

Audi e-tron GT Insurance Rates by Driver Age
Driver Age Premium
16 $7,342
20 $4,900
30 $2,240
40 $2,108
50 $1,918
60 $1,886

Full coverage, $500 deductibles

Rates by Deductible

Audi e-tron GT Insurance Rates with Different Deductibles
Deductible Premium
$100 $2,834
$250 $2,494
$500 $2,108
$1,000 $1,736

Full coverage, driver age 40
